NewsBreak vs Taboola: Which Native Platform Wins?
Both sell content-style ads to people reading the news. Under the hood they’re different machines: one owned app with a first-party feed versus a recommendation widget spread across thousands of publisher sites. That structural difference decides almost everything downstream.

NewsBreak and Taboola both sell native, content-style ads — but NewsBreak is one owned app while Taboola is a widget network across thousands of publisher sites.
NewsBreak: US-only, 45+ skew, first-party feed, reported CPCs around $0.08–0.15 in cheap verticals, $10/day entry. Taboola: global reach, premium publisher placements, reported CPCs ~$0.25–0.70, more tooling and scale headroom.
The pick: NewsBreak for 45+ US lead-gen on tight budgets; Taboola for global scale and publisher-context control. Serious content-ad operations eventually test both.
The structural difference

Everything downstream — price, consistency, brand safety — follows from this structural split.
NewsBreak sells its own feed. Every impression renders inside the NewsBreak app or site, between local-news stories, under one design system and one review pipeline. First-party inventory means no publisher variance: the ad experience is the same in every placement.
Taboola sells other people’s pages. Its recommendation widgets sit on thousands of publisher sites — from premium news brands to long-tail content farms — so your ad’s context varies enormously placement by placement, and placement-level optimization (whitelisting, blacklisting) becomes a core skill.
Neither structure is “better” — they’re different products. One is a single venue with a known crowd; the other is a distribution network with reach no single app matches.
Audience: owned skew vs sampled reach
NewsBreak: self-reported 45M+ monthly US users, concentrated 45+, local-news-engaged — the full breakdown is in our demographics guide. You buy a known cohort by default.
Taboola: reach wherever its publishers are — global, all ages, every context from finance news to celebrity slideshows. You can reach the 45+ US news reader, but you’re sampling them across a network rather than owning their feed, and targeting discipline decides how much of your spend actually lands there.

Pricing: what buyers report
None of the native platforms publish rate cards, so these are community-reported ranges — label them accordingly when you plan:
| Platform | Reported CPC range | Entry point |
|---|---|---|
| NewsBreak | ~$0.08–0.15 (cheap verticals) | $10/day minimum |
| Taboola | ~$0.25–0.70 | Practical minimums in the hundreds |
| Outbrain | ~$0.40–0.80+ | Similar; premium-publisher lean |
NewsBreak’s discount is real but has structural causes — a younger auction, one owned app, an audience social buyers ignore — covered in the cost guide. Taboola’s premium buys distribution breadth and a decade of optimization tooling.
Is NewsBreak cheaper than Taboola?
By community reports, meaningfully — roughly a third of Taboola’s typical CPC in comparable verticals. But Taboola’s network reach and placement controls can win on volume and CPA at scale; cheap clicks only matter if the audience converts.
Quality control and brand safety
NewsBreak’s advantage is consistency: one app, one review pipeline, IAB-category brand-suitability controls at article level. Its honest caveat is content quality at the source — a June 2024 Reuters investigation documented dozens of inaccurate AI-generated stories on the platform, drawing US lawmaker scrutiny. If your brand team asks, that reporting exists and should inform placement decisions.
Taboola’s challenge is variance: premium publishers sit alongside clickbait-adjacent long-tail sites in the same network, and your brand’s context depends on your blocklists. Its advantage: you can literally choose publishers — a control NewsBreak’s single-app model doesn’t need or offer.
Tracking and tooling
- NewsBreak: pixel + server-to-server postback, documented tracker integrations (RedTrack, ClickBank, CPV Lab, ClickFlare), a full Advertising API and a Shopify app. Young but genuinely complete — setup steps in the setup guide.
- Taboola: a decade of maturity — granular placement reporting, established S2S ecosystem, retargeting depth, and account-management tiers at spend.
The verdict by use case
- 45+ US lead-gen (insurance, home, health, finance): NewsBreak first — the audience is the default and the clicks are cheapest.
- Global or non-US campaigns: Taboola — NewsBreak is US-only, full stop.
- Publisher-context control matters: Taboola — you pick the sites.
- Testing native on a small budget: NewsBreak — $10/day entry vs practical hundreds.
- At scale: both — most serious content-ad operations run NewsBreak for the owned 45+ feed and Taboola for network reach, judged on blended CPA.
